Output e8f9f6d4cf41f92e3e77e705dde5fc83cd03710fedcf85dc29e75bdd0bb6d2db:0

value
21234683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19ad2e0c75695a6aacdeb0f2386cac14e3ebcae1 OP_EQUAL
address
342nH65VTKNKvCY3paHKbfDNHm5gjtiwqC
transaction
e8f9f6d4cf41f92e3e77e705dde5fc83cd03710fedcf85dc29e75bdd0bb6d2db
confirmations
396977
spent
true